Turning Smiles into Rewards: Crafting a Patient Loyalty Program That Clicks
Creating a successful patient loyalty program begins with understanding what motivates your patients and what they value most. Think beyond simple discounts—consider offering personalized rewards like free dental cleanings after a certain number of visits or wellness checkups. Make the process fun and engaging, such as earning points for each appointment or referral, which can be redeemed for services, small gifts, or wellness goodies. The key is to develop a system that’s easy to understand and accessible, ensuring patients feel excited to participate rather than overwhelmed.
Communication is also crucial. Use friendly reminders, thank-you notes, and updates about their rewards to keep the engagement lively. Incorporate technology like a mobile app or digital portal where patients can track their points, view special offers, or even schedule appointments seamlessly. Creating a sense of community and personalized touch can foster loyalty—celebrate patient milestones or birthdays with small tokens of appreciation, making them feel valued beyond just their dental health. Remember, a loyalty program isn’t just about discounts; it’s about building a relationship rooted in trust and mutual care.
Finally, evaluate and adapt your program regularly. Gather feedback from your patients about what rewards they enjoy and what could be improved. Use this data to refine your offerings and make the program more appealing. Keep the excitement alive by introducing seasonal promotions or surprise rewards, ensuring your program remains fresh and engaging. Boost Patient Happiness and Retention with These Simple Loyalty Ideas
Start small by offering straightforward rewards—like a free toothbrush or dental floss after a certain number of visits—to get your patients excited and involved. Simple gestures can go a long way in creating happiness; consider sending personalized thank-you notes or holiday greetings to make your patients feel special. Incorporate small, meaningful incentives that reinforce their decision to stay loyal, such as discounts on future treatments or family package deals. These thoughtful touches can turn routine appointments into moments of joy that reinforce their connection to your practice.
Another effective idea is to introduce referral rewards. Encourage satisfied patients to bring friends and family by offering incentives for each new patient they refer—like a discounted checkup or a small gift. This creates a win-win situation: your existing patients feel appreciated, and your practice grows organically through trust and word-of-mouth. Additionally, consider hosting occasional patient appreciation events or wellness workshops to foster community spirit and demonstrate that you genuinely care about their overall health. Happy patients are loyal patients, and these simple ideas help nurture that happiness.
Lastly, leverage digital tools to maintain ongoing engagement. Send friendly reminders for checkups, birthday wishes, or exclusive offers through email or text messages. Make it easy for patients to participate in your loyalty program with digital tracking or app-based rewards. By maintaining consistent, cheerful communication, you reinforce their positive experience and keep your practice top of mind.
